Neurocam Automatically Records Only What You’re Interested in

The Neurocam is the latest invention from Neurowear – the minds behind the Necomimi cat ears and that tail that wags tail that wags based on your thoughts. Though this one seems like a slightly more useful, if not still strange device.

neurocam 620x343magnify

The Neurocam monitors brainwave activity to monitor your interest level in things you’re observing. When it senses that your interest threshold has been hit, it automatically captures images or video. In its current state, the system automatically creates 5-second GIFs of interesting subjects. Here’s a brief video demo of the Neurocam in action:

The device is a headband that holds the users smartphone in a bracket, and it appears that it also has some sort of 90-degree lens adapter for the smartphone so it captures images of whatever you’re looking at.

Samsung explores touchless tablet interaction with brainwave technology

Samsung explores touchless tablet interaction with brainwave technology

Try and wrap this one around your noggin. Samsung is currently working with researchers at the University of Texas on a project involving EEG caps that harnesses the power of one’s mind to control tablets and smartphones, and if that weren’t enough, the company’s actually hoping to take it mainstream. Now, before we get too far ahead of ourselves, let’s be clear: in its current stage, the system is cumbersome and aimed at those with disabilities, but Samsung’s already proven that it’s interested in alternative input methods, and this could certainly be the logical conclusion.

As is, participants are asked to wear EEG caps that measure the electrical activity along their scalp. Then, they’re able to make selections by focusing on an icon that flashes at a distinct frequency from others, which the system recognizes as a unique electrical pattern. Overall, the accuracy of the system is in the ballpark of 80 to 95 percent, and users are able to make selections on average of every five seconds. In order to make the system more approachable, the researchers hope to develop EEG hats that are more convenient and less intrusive — in other words, ones that people can wear throughout the day. Duke melds two rats’ minds through the internet, Spock may not approve

Duke University melds two rats' thoughts over the internet we're not sure Spock would approve

Some would say the internet already lets us share every minute detail of our thoughts, much to our followers’ dismay. Duke University isn’t deterred by our behavior — if anything, it just took oversharing literally by connecting two rats’ minds in an experiment, first in a lab and ultimately online. Electrodes attached to the brain of a host “encoder” rat in Brazil processed the motor-oriented mental activity for a desired behavior, such as pressing a lever on cue, and converted it into a signal that was then received by a “decoder” rat as far away as Duke’s US campus. The majority of the time, the decoder rat performed the same action as the encoder. Researchers also found that rewarding the encoder alongside the decoder created a virtuous loop, as treating the first rat for a job well done focused its attention and improved the signal strength.

We’re not sure that Vulcans would endorse this kind of mind meld, though: apart from immediately depriving the decoder rat of self-control, prolonged testing led to the same rodent developing additional sympathetic reactions to the encoder. There’s also concerns that the test was too binary and didn’t reflect the complexity of the whole brain. All the same, Duke’s study is proof enough that we can export brainwaves in a meaningful way.

PLX’s XWave Sport gives brainwave interfaces a casual look, triggers ’80s flashbacks

PLX's XWave Sport gives brainwave interfaces a casual look, triggers '80s flashbacks

Brainwave-guided interfaces are common. Most of the time, though, they’re not what we’d call subtle. PLX Devices hopes to have that licked through the XWave Sport, a brain interface that disguises all its sensors through a fuzzy, exercise-friendly headband. Underneath the incredibly 1980s-retro (but washable!) look, you’ll get about six hours per charge of tracking for concentration, relaxation and other noggin-related data that can transmit over Bluetooth to apps for Android, iOS or old-fashioned PCs. An SDK is available now, but pre-orders for the $100 XWave Sport won’t ship until September 20th. That should give us enough time to perfect our Flashdance reenactments.
